kuivaaineksia
Kuiva-ainekset refers to the solid components of a substance that remain after all moisture has been removed. In many contexts, this term is used in the food industry, where it indicates the percentage of non-water content in a food product. For example, a cheese might have a high kuiva-ainekset percentage, meaning it contains a large proportion of solids like fat, protein, and carbohydrates, and relatively little water. This is important for understanding the nutritional value, texture, and shelf-life of food.
